Nnlloyd max quantizer pdf

Suppose that qx is a quantizer which satisfies the above two conditions centroid. It utilizes a preprogrammed pic which is included with purchase of a pcb. Quantization design electrical and computer engineering programs. Digital signal processing 2 advanced digital signal processing lecture 4, lloyd max quantizer, lbg gerald schuller, tu ilmenau lloyd max quantizer look at the histogram of a typical mixed speech and music file. Consider a symmetric scalar quantizer with 3 intervals, qx 8 a and a quantizer input with a zeromean laplace pdf, fx 1 2m e jxj m a derive the optimal reconstruction value bas a function of the decision threshold afor mse distortion. The bargain botheration can be declared as follows. The following table lists the readonly quantizer object states.

The most convenient and widely used measure of distortion between the input signal x and the quantized signal y. While it is sad, at least her last shoot is pretty awesome, and as she put it, she is going out while shes on the top of her game. I am trying to implement a delta sigma modulator block diagram in matlab simulink but cant find a 1 bit quantizer which is required in the modulator anywhere. An effective method for initialization of lloyd max s algorithm of optimal scalar quantization for laplacian source is proposed. For the commonly used uniform adc, this approximation is only valid at high resolution see 914 and 2831. This is a function of analogtodigital converters, which create a series of digital values to represent the original analog signal. Lloyd max quantizer,plots,mse the source code and files included in this project are listed in the project files section, please make sure whether the listed source code meet your needs there. Abstractlvalues have been widely adopted due to their outstanding features in many scenarios of digital communication. Quantization levels are the centroidof their region 2. This circuit takes a continuously variable dc voltage and outputs only voltages related to each other musically, using the 1voctave standard. Lloyd max is a special type of scalar quantizer design which is optimized in terms of mse to source pdf. An effective method for initialization of lloydmaxs.

The quantizer block discretizes the input signal using a quantization algorithm. A number of different probability density functions are supported. For example, if the data to be coded is a grayscale image quantized to 8. Image quantization lloydmax quantizer image transforms remarks 1 two commonly used pdfs for quantization of image related data are. Hey rdsp, ive been struggling so far with my homework as a 2nd year engineering student. I think it does lloyd i algorithm and it uses a training set and not a pdf for design. Finding an optimal solution to the above problem results in a quantizer sometimes called a mmsqe minimum meansquare quantization error solution, and the resulting pdfoptimized nonuniform quantizer is referred to as a lloydmax quantizer, named after two people who independently developed iterative methods to solve the two sets of. So, the maximum quantization error that can be incurred is. New equivalent model of quantizer with noisy input and its. Color image quantization is a much more complex clustering problem because of the threedimensional histogram involved. Lloyds algorithm and the more generalized lbg algorithm is a scheme to design vector quantization. An effective method for initialization of lloyd max s algorithm 281 2.

Lloyd max quantizer the lloyd max algorithm is a wellknown approach to designing nonuniform quantizers optimized according to the prevailing pdf of the input signal. The following matlab project contains the source code and matlab examples used for lloyd max quantizer,plots,mse. Quantize fixedpoint numbers matlab quantize mathworks nordic. An analogtodigital converter adc works as a quantizer. A uniform quantizer can be easily specified by its lower bound and the step size. Quantizer simulink reference northwestern university. Quantizer definition of quantizer by the free dictionary. Lloyd max quantizer codes and scripts downloads free. Lloyd max quantizer,plots,mse in matlab download free. The idea is to decomposes the space into a cartesian product of low dimensional subspaces and to quantize each subspace separately. A novel approximate lloydmax quantizer and its analysis. A smooth input signal can take on a stairstep shape after quantization. Introduction basic quantization lloyd max raw images transformed images generalizations 1.

Lloyd max s algorithm implementation in speech coding algorithm 257 2002. Assuming that you know the pdf of the samples to be quantized design the quantizer s step so that it is optimal for that pdf. An efficient lloyd max quantizer for matching pursuit decompositions. A lloydmax based quantizer of lvalues for awgn and. Uniform and nonuniform quantization of gaussian processes oleg seleznjeva,b. A genetic lloydmax image quantization algorithm sciencedirect. Minimizing the mutual information loss due to quantization given a certain compression rate is the key point of quantizer design for lvalues. Lloyd max quantizer lloyd,1957 max,1960 m1 decision thresholds exactly halfway between representative levels.

Assume that the number m of quantizer levels and the pdf fu u are given. The snr is defined as the ratio of the expectation of the signal power to the expectation of the noise power. The two can be solved iteratively to obtain an optimal quantizer. For this example, the procedure stopped in one iteration. The improvement in sqnr due to osr occurs only after the signal has been filtered via a channel filter. Pdf of u is roughly constant over individual cells ck. A lloydmax based quantizer of lvalues for awgn and rayleigh. Feb 24, 2009 here is a brief run down of how a cv quantizer can change your sound with analog synthesis. Nonlinear tonetransfer curve of quantizer, showing a linear region. For uniform pdf x max x f x x 12x max want to uniformly quantize an rv x ux max,x max assume that desire m rls for r. Abstractthis paper introduces a product quantization based approach for approximate nearest neighbor search. For the purposes of this discussion let us assume that the source signal xn is a wide sense stationary wss random signal that has a. A quantizer is a logarithmic function that performs quantization rounding off the value. Therefore the problem of local optima is expected to become more important.

Product quantization for nearest neighbor search herve j. If i load the main scalemaster2 max patch and patch up the notein through to the noteout in the examples section. Discretize input at given interval simulink mathworks. Design scalar quantizer with 4 quantization indices with minimum expected distortion d. The lloyd max quantizer is known to be the best quantizer for a given source. Lloydmaxs algorithm implementation in speech coding. However, for a source that does not have a uniform distribution, the minimum.

The aforementioned adaptivity of speech coding system can be achieved by using. For a signal x with given pdf find a quantizer with m representative levels such that fx x solution. Also, implementing a uniform quantizer is easier than a nonuniform quantizer. The set of inputs and outputs of a quantizer can be scalars scalar quantizer. Uniform quantization an overview sciencedirect topics. As a 2nd year student with absolutely no background about any kinds of signal processing, i simply cannot deal with it. This is a type of nonuniform quantizer, which is adapted to the signals pdf. Rather than allocate a uniform step size, as would be optimum for a uniform pdf, the lloyd max approach identifies decision boundaries according to the mean values of equal area partitions of the pdf curve. The s input specifies the sign to be used in numerictype s,16,15.

Quantization part 3 ece 285 cheolhong an properties of lloyd max quantizer if if is uniform, that is, lloyd max. An effective method for initialization of lloydmaxs algorithm 281 2. This type of quantization is referred to as non uniform quantization. Pdf an effective method for initialization of lloydmaxs. Assume we have a ad converter with a quantizer with a certain number of bits say n bits, what is the resulting signal to noise ratio snr of this quantizer. Optimal pdf of reconstruction levels is not the same as. As highlighted in 5, 6 for high bitrates lloyd max s quantizer is complex to design and, accordingly, an optimal companding quantizer, which is simpler to design and which has. Quantizer article about quantizer by the free dictionary. Quantization information theory, ieee transactions on.

Find the decision boundaries and reconstruction levels of the optimal lloyd max quantizer with three bins m3 for this source hints 1. Azimi, professor department of electrical and computer engineering colorado state university. The title is quantization signal processing, so i dont see anything wrong with illustrations of signals i. Lloydsmax algorithm for signal quantization youtube. Download lloyd max quantizer source codes, lloyd max. Lloyd max quantizer for optimal quantization of a random. Applicable when the signal is in a finite range f min. Discretize input at given interval simulink mathworks italia.

For each, the quantizer can additionally be constrained to have symmetrically spaced levels. Lloyd max s quantizer is an optimal quantizer for the given. In meshsmoothing applications, these would be the vertices of the mesh to be smoothed. Pdf in this paper, a dpcm differential pulse code modulation system with forward adaptive lloyd max s quantizer is presented. Probabilistic methods that search for the desired input signal which maximizes the likelihood. Wpwmax is happy to announce a 12 off special offer on all our videos now through 11.

Lloyd max s quantizer is an optimal quantizer for the given probability density function and is simple for design and implementation only for low bitrates. Ee398a image and video compression quantization no. Max is a multiplatform compatible script that returns the lowest and highest numeric values in an array. Lloyd max quantizer lloyd,1957 max,1960 m1 decision thresholds exactly halfway between representative. And of course the fullsized picture is better than the thumbnail pic. The lloyd max quantizer is actually a uniform quantizer when the input pdf is uniformly distributed over the range y 1. In this paper a quantizer, based on a genetic algorithm ga, is defined which is more insensitive to initial conditions. Analog quantizing quantizer quantize modular youtube. Pdf analysis of differential pulse code modulation with. A lloyd max based quantizer of lvalues for awgn and rayleigh fading channel yasser samayoa, jo. Its about different scalar quantization techniques, and one of those is lloyd max quantizer. Quantization is the process of converting a continuous range of values into a finite range of discreet values. Merchant, department of electrical engineering, iit bombay. Solution depends on input pdf and can be done numerically for.

Uniform and nonuniform quantization of gaussian processes. The block uses a roundtonearest method to map signal values to quantized values at the output that are defined by the quantization interval. Max s file uploader is an object oriented file uploder script written in php. Assuming that you know the pdf of the samples to be quantized design the quantizers step so that it is optimal for that pdf. They are updated during the quantizer quantize method, and are reset by the resetlog function. Description of the lloyds algorithm for quantization in the communication systems lifecycle.

Reconstruction levels of quantizer are uniformly spaced quantizer step size, i. Assuming a continuous and finite support probability distribution of the source, we show that our alm quantizer converges to the classical lloyd max quantizer with increasing bitrate. Digital signal processing 2 advanced digital signal. The quantizer block passes its input signal through a stairstep function so that many neighboring points on the input axis are mapped to one point on the output axis. The lloyd max algorithm 10 is a wellknown approach to designing nonuniform quantizers optimized according to the prevailing pdf of the input signal. Introduction basic quantization lloyd max raw images transformed images generalizations 1 introduction.

Lloyd max quantizer for optimal quantization of a random variable demonstrating a gaussian pdf lloyd max. Boundaries of the quantization regions are the midpoint of the quantization values clearly 1 depends on 2 and vice versa. Motivated by this concern, we propose a novel quantization scheme called approximate lloyd max alm that is nearlyoptimal. The following figure illustrates an example for a quantization error, indicating the difference between the original signal and the quantized signal. Lloyds algorithm starts by an initial placement of some number k of point sites in the input domain. Advanced digital signal processing lecture 4, lloydmax quantizer. Scalar and vector quantization national chiao tung. Since in this short interval, properties of the speech signal remain roughly constant, it can be viewed as a local stationary signal. Presented is a simple patch with no quantizing, and then quantizing is added with a run through of the. The pdf of the quantization noise can be obtained by slicing and stacking the pdf of x, as was done for the uniform quantizer and illustrated in fig. Novel nearoptimal scalar quantizers with exponential. The solution can be found by solving equations directly. Solved lloydmax quantizer design design a tenlevel.

He has received an nsf grant titled datadriven adaptive quantization for distributed inference, addresses a fundamental challenge of quantization for distributed inference in a sensor network environment, where the optimum quantizer generally cannot be implemented due to its dependence on unknown parameters associated with the random events being monitored by the sensor network. The problem about this quantizer is that it is iterative. Pdf is not uniform, it is not good idea to obtain the step size by simply dividing the. Quantize definition is to subdivide something, such as energy into small but measurable increments. That is, in order to obtain the improvement in sqnr due to oversampling, the signal at the output of the adc has to be filtered and its bandwidth reduced to the occupied signal bandwidth. For uniform pdfx max x f x x 12x max want to uniformly quantize an rv x ux max,x max assume that desire m rls for r. Average distortion closedform solutions for pdf optimized uniform quantizers for gaussian rv only exist for n2 and n3 optimization of is conducted numerically v u k, k k p k k0 n 1 1, k d 1 12 p k k 2 k0 n 1. The quantizer distortion the quality of a quantizer can be measured by the distortion of the resulting reproduction in comparison to the original. Revision history for rev 4 boards, read this documentation.

146 1343 861 205 612 1276 1010 858 936 718 934 1400 528 337 1208 695 684 235 48 1431 1341 606 137 369 1452 785 554 31 1320 458 700 1265